When preparing for the upcoming humid rainy season known as tsuyu (梅雨) in Japan, bookstore and oddity shop Village Vanguard might not seem like it's at the top of the list for supplies to stock up on, but their line up of fantasy-themed one piece dresses may actually have an offering for those who want to ward off the rainy season in style. Village Vanguard's latest addition from designer "Favorite" is Princess Snow White poncho-style raincoat.
Despite the frills and lace, the coat is designed for wet and muggy weather with elastic polyester. Although it's advertised as a "kawaii" alternative to raincoats and panchos, Village Vanguard suggests the outfit for cosplay and fun dress up photos on social media.
With expected shipping set for July 2019, the cute raincoat is available from Village Vanguard's online shop (Japan only) for 15,098 yen.
